[QUOTE="UpstateNYUPSer(Ret), post: 1061992, member: 12570"] Payments from supplemental insurance are set by the insurer and are not based on your paychecks. I had bi-lateral ulnar nerve release surgery on both elbows a few years ago. I was off for two weeks and had light duty for two more. I received a check for $880 from comp and for $1000 from Combined. The benefit schedule and premiums increase 5% each year. [/QUOTE]
